JohnFromNorway on Oct 11, 2023
The hotel is located near the Central Station and in a nice restaurant area. The staff makes you welcome and that is always a plus. The room was compact but a plus for bathtub. Had single bed and that was too narrow, will go for double bed next time. Simple but nice interior in the room. More classy in the rest of the hotel. A beautiful back yard is a great place to chill out.

A good 3 star near the Milan Train station. Just 7 min walk from Milan FS Centrale, surrounded by kits of restaurants. I would describe the Hotel as a step up from a B&B. Rooms were a good size with a good sized bathroom. Two pillows and standard - basic decor. There was a kettle and free coffee and tea in the room. TV was good as well. Bed was comfortable. Bathroom was a good size, however, the shower was quite small. The door would barely open, and I could squeeze in. For bigger people it maybe a problem. The walls are quite thin. One night there was a couple arguing in the corridor then in the room and you could hear everything. The staff was very friendly and helpful. It was interesting when I checked out I wasn’t asked if I enjoyed the stay. I was there for two night.
